Output 6589c14ce7efbabae1a7885e8da54e5f0a91694aee864b105acc516d77413abc:3

value
18391546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46d51e5dab0120098e6f25fcc7f39db1daaa7c25 OP_EQUAL
address
389YXiJhD4CGDfXzwkrJUqJD1qxsyNivwx
transaction
6589c14ce7efbabae1a7885e8da54e5f0a91694aee864b105acc516d77413abc
spent
true